Where this album fits

Career context
Generation X released their self-titled debut album in 1978, marking their entrance into the UK punk scene. This album came shortly after the band's formation in 1976 and showcased their energetic sound at a time when punk was rapidly evolving, setting the stage for their subsequent influence on the genre.
